Nginxwebui

Nginxwebui

简介 

Nginx Web UI 是一个用于管理和配置 Nginx 服务器的用户界面工具。它提供直观的图形界面,使得用户能够更方便地设置和维护 Nginx 配置,而无需直接编辑配置文件。

部署

docker-compose.yaml
version: '3.8'
services:
  nginxwebui:
    image: cym1102/nginxwebui:4.2.4
    container_name: nginxwebui             # 容器名称
    restart: always                        # 自动重启
    environment:
      BOOT_OPTIONS: "--server.port=8081"   # 定义服务访问端口
    privileged: true                       # 特权模式
    network_mode: "host"                   # host网络模式
    deploy:
      resources:
        limits:
          cpus: "0.5"                      # 限制 CPU 核心数
          memory: "512M"                   # 限制内存大小
    volumes:
      - ./nginxWebUI:/home/nginxWebUI   # 数据持久化

## 启动

docker compose up -d